Seafood Soup: A Culinary Delight Found in Restaurants Across the USA

Seafood soup, a delectable dish that tantalizes taste buds with its rich flavors and diverse ingredients, has become a culinary staple in restaurants across the United States. This hearty and flavorful soup is a testament to the country's diverse culinary landscape, showcasing the freshest seafood and local ingredients.

Origins and Variations

Seafood soup has its roots in various cultures worldwide, with each region adding its unique twist to the dish. In the United States, seafood soup has evolved into a melting pot of flavors, incorporating elements from New England clam chowder, French bouillabaisse, and Asian seafood stews.

Ingredients and Preparation

The ingredients in seafood soup vary widely depending on the region and the chef's creativity. However, some common ingredients include:

  • Seafood
    Shrimp, crab, lobster, mussels, clams, and fish are all popular choices.
  • Vegetables
    Onions, celery, carrots, potatoes, and tomatoes provide a flavorful base.
  • Broth
    Seafood stock, chicken stock, or vegetable broth forms the liquid foundation.
  • Seasonings
    Herbs, spices, and aromatics such as garlic, thyme, bay leaves, and saffron enhance the soup's flavor.
  • The preparation of seafood soup typically involves sautéing the vegetables in butter or olive oil, adding the seafood and broth, and simmering until the seafood is cooked through. Some soups may also include a thickening agent such as flour or cornstarch to create a richer consistency.
